Understanding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ered devices designed for individuals with restricted mobility. They offer a means of transportation for people who may have problem walking however still want to keep their self-reliance. They are available in numerous designs and features to cater to a vast array of needs.

The choice of mobility scooter typically depends on the functions that line up with private needs. Here are a few of the crucial functions to consider:
Weight Capacity: new mobility scooters scooters feature various weight limits. It is crucial to choose a scooter that can properly support the user's weight.
Variety: The range a scooter can take a trip on a single charge varies. Depending upon user needs, one may go with scooters with a variety of up to 40 miles.
Speed: Most buying mobility scooter scooters can reach speeds in between 4 to 8 miles per hour. Consider what is the best mobility scooter to buy uk speed is comfortable and safe for the intended environment.
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is important for indoor usage, permitting much easier navigation in tight spaces.
Battery Type: The type of batteries utilized can impact the scooter's efficiency.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most typical.
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ters
The advantages of mobility scooters extend beyond simply transport. Some key advantages consist of:
Independence: Users can navigate their environment without counting on caretakers, promoting self-reliance and self-esteem.
Health Benefits: Using a scooter can motivate outdoor activity, resulting in physical and psychological health improvements by lowering feelings of isolation.
Convenience: Scooters can easily be run in different environments, whether inside your home, in shopping center, or outdoors.

1. How quick do mobility scooter stores scooters go?Mobility scooters usually have speeds ranging from 4 to 8 miles per hour, with most developed for safety rather than high-speed travel. 2. Exist weight constraints on mobility scooters?Yes, mobility
scooters come with particular weight limits, typically ranging from
250 pounds to over 500 lbs, depending on the model. 3. Can mobility scooters be utilized indoors?Certain models, especially compact scooters, are particularly developed for
indoor use and are easier to steer in tight areas. 4. How frequently do the batteries need to be replaced?Battery life can vary based on usage, but generally, with correct care, batteries might last in between 1 to 3 years before needing replacement
. 5.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?Coverage can differ, however some insurance coverage plans, consisting of Medicare and Medicaid, may cover part of the cost. It's recommended to contact private insurance companies. Mobility scooters function as a
